Can You Drink Alcohol While Taking Clindamycin?

The short answer is: it's generally considered safe to drink alcohol in moderation while taking clindamycin, but it's best to consult your doctor. There's no direct interaction between clindamycin and alcohol that causes a dangerous chemical reaction like some drug combinations. However, there are potential indirect effects to consider.

What is Clindamycin?

Clindamycin is an antibiotic used to treat various bacterial infections, including skin infections, pneumonia, and pelvic inflammatory disease. It works by inhibiting bacterial protein synthesis, effectively stopping the growth and spread of bacteria.

Does Clindamycin Interact Directly with Alcohol?

No, there's no known direct chemical interaction between clindamycin and alcohol. This means that the alcohol won't change how the clindamycin works in your body, nor will the clindamycin alter the metabolism of alcohol.

Why the Caution Despite the Lack of Direct Interaction?

While a direct reaction is unlikely, the following factors should be considered:

  • Side Effects: Clindamycin can cause side effects such as nausea, vomiting, and diarrhea. Alcohol can exacerbate these gastrointestinal issues, making you feel even more unwell. The combination might increase your discomfort and could potentially lead to dehydration.

  • Medication Effectiveness: While not directly impacting clindamycin's effectiveness, significant alcohol consumption could potentially compromise your overall health and well-being, potentially hindering your body's ability to fight off infection. This is more of an indirect effect than a direct interaction.

  • Individual Sensitivity: Some people are more sensitive to alcohol's effects than others. If you're already prone to feeling unwell after consuming alcohol, taking clindamycin might worsen these feelings.

  • Other Medications: If you're taking other medications alongside clindamycin, alcohol could interact with those medications, creating additional risks. Always inform your doctor about all the medications and supplements you are using.

What Happens if You Drink Alcohol While Taking Clindamycin?

You're unlikely to experience a severe reaction, but you might experience increased side effects like nausea, vomiting, or upset stomach. The severity will depend on factors such as the amount of alcohol consumed, your individual tolerance, and your overall health.

How Much Alcohol is Too Much While on Clindamycin?

There isn't a specific amount of alcohol deemed "too much" while taking clindamycin. However, moderation is key. Limiting your alcohol intake or abstaining altogether is advisable to minimize the risk of experiencing exacerbated side effects. It's always best to err on the side of caution.
